Overview Rutobal D Tablet

Dolprin-D tablets offer relief from pain and inflammation. This medication effectively manages discomfort associated with conditions such as r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and osteoarthritis. It also provides relief from muscular aches, back pain, dental pain, and ear/throat discomfort. For optimal absorption and to minimize stomach upset, Dolprin-D should be taken with food. Dosage is determined by the specific condition being treated and the patient's response, always following your physician's instructions. Exceeding the prescribed dose or duration is strongly discouraged. Common side effects may include nausea, vomiting, indigestion, diarrhea, abdominal pain, and decreased appetite. Report any persistent or worsening side effects to your doctor, who can advise on mitigation strategies.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or of any pre-existing conditions such as stomach ulcers or bleeding, hypertension, or cardiovascular, renal, or hepatic impairment. Full disclosure of all other medications being taken is essential due to potential interactions. Women who are pregnant or breastfeeding should seek medical advice before using Dolprin-D. Alcohol consumption should be avoided during treatment to prevent excessive sleepiness.

How Rutobal D Tablet works:

Rutobal D Tablet integrates four active components: bromelain, diclofenac, rutoside, and trypsin-chymotrypsin. Bromelain and trypsin-chymotrypsin, both enzymes, enhance circulation and stimulate the body's natural pain and inflammation-reducing mechanisms. Diclofenac, a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ID), inhibits the production of prostaglandins—brain-released chemicals triggering pain and inflammation. Rutoside, an antioxidant, counteracts free radical damage and contributes to decreased swelling.
